This title in the popular Did YouKnow? series from Young Reed, is an attractive andfun book packed with fascinating facts about theever-popular subject of Kiwi. A national symboland cultural icon of New Zealand, Kiwi areremarkable birds in many ways. Did You Know? They are the only birds in the world to have nos-trils at the end of their beak, helping them to findfood as they snuffle around on the forest floor. Kiwi eggs are huge for the size of the bird up toone fifth of the female s body weight. Rails calledWeka are sometimes confused with Kiwi, but theyare much less shy so if the bird you re looking atis trying to steal your sandwiches from your back-pack it ll be a Weka!Each spread covers a different aspect of Kiwi life,from Special adaptations and Conserving Kiwi to Closest relatives and Where do they live? .The book contains bite-sized chunks ofinteresting information coupled with stunningphotographs, which combine to make this anengaging and entertaining introduction to thesubject that s bound to capture the imagination ofany reader.
